PARTNER SUCCESS STORY PRAXIS COMPUTING A crucial component to success, however, would be the deploy- ment of a stable Wide Area Network (WAN). Rich Morris, Hitchcock’s VP of Information Systems notes, “When I was considering running two of our largest stores over a WAN, a big concern was insuring that links between the stores and the central server would be fast and exceedingly reliable. Any network outage meant hundreds of employees standing idle, and lost sales revenue. Downtime during a weekend promotion would be catastrophic.” SELECTING A PARTNER Morris envisioned a robust computer network to provide uninterrupted high-performance service. “The success of this project depended upon building the network from best-of-class components,” says Morris. “In my mind that meant Cisco hardware and Cisco certified engineers.” At initial meetings, vendors were proposing solutions that did not meet his stringent requirements. “Most firms we talked to suggested ‘boiler plate’ solutions — they all wanted to sell me on their current promo- tion. I was told that the performance and stability I wanted wasn’t technically feasible,” he says. But what impressed me most was that Praxis had references that actually chased me down so they could tell me how pleased they were with the success of their network projects.” DESIGNING THE NETWORK Success with previous WAN projects contributed to Praxis Computing’s ability to efficiently design and deploy a solution for Hitchcock Automotive. However, the Praxis design for Hitchcock represented a unique combination of products precisely configured to meet Hitchcock’s stringent performance, reliability, and security requirements. During the design, Praxis worked closely with Cisco field engineers to review network design scenarios. Jeff Roback, president of Praxis Computing, worked with his dedicated team to design a WAN connecting Hitchcock’s various dealerships using T1, ISDN, and VPN technologies. Built to take full advantage of the advanced capabilities that Cisco equipment delivers, the network was also designed to ensure Morris’ requirements for availability, performance and security were met at all points throughout the network.
